About D-Veniz 100 Tablet ER
D-Veniz 100 Tablet ER is an antidepressant medicine used in the treatment of major depressive disorder. It helps restore the balance of natural brain chemicals — serotonin and noradrenaline — that influence mood and emotional stability. By improving nerve communication and reducing anxiety, it helps relieve symptoms of depression and enhances overall mental well-being.

How D-Veniz 100 Tablet ER Works
D-Veniz 100 Tablet ER contains Desvenlafaxine, a serotonin-nor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or (SNRI). It works by increasing the levels of serotonin and noradrenaline — two neurotransmitters responsible for maintaining emotional balance and mood regulation. This action helps reduce feelings of sadness, hopelessness, and anxiety, while improving concentration and motivation.
Directions for Use
- Take the tablet exactly as prescribed by your doctor.
- Swallow it whole with a glass of water — do not crush or chew.
- Can be taken with or without food, preferably at the same time daily.
- Do not stop taking this medicine suddenly without consulting your doctor, as withdrawal symptoms may occur.
Possible Side Effects
- Nausea or vomiting
- Dizziness or drowsiness
- Constipation or decreased appetite
- Increased sweating
- Anxiety or restlessness
- Insomnia (difficulty sleeping)
- Sexual dysfunction
- Blurred vision
Most side effects are mild and temporary. Consult your doctor if they persist or become bothersome.
Safety Advice
- Alcohol: Avoid alcohol as it may increase drowsiness and dizziness.
- Pregnancy: Use only if prescribed by your doctor after evaluating risks and benefits.
- Breastfeeding: Not recommended as the medicine may pass into breast milk.
- Driving: Avoid driving or operating machinery until you know how the medicine affects you.
- Kidney/Liver Impairment: Dose adjustment may be required; consult your physician.

What If You Miss a Dose?
Take the missed dose as soon as you remember. If it’s close to your next scheduled dose, skip the missed one and continue your regular dosing schedule. Do not double up doses.
